FENSA Roadshow to visit South West & North West in 2018

Events, News | 24.09.18

[one_fourth]fensa logo[/one_fourth]

[three_fourth]

FENSA is a government authorised Competent Person Scheme for the replacement of windows, doors, roof windows and roof lights in England and Wales against the relevant Building Regulations.

Learn more at fensa.org.uk

[/three_fourth]

[full_width]

FENSA is hitting the road this September, October and November to bring its free and info-packed roadshows to FENSA installers throughout the South West and North West.

FENSA works with thousands of double glazing contractors in England and Wales that have been assessed for their ability to install replacement windows and doors in accordance with the relevant Building Regulations.

Member installers can self-certify compliance under the Building Regulations without the need for a separate assessment from Building Control.

Since being established in 2002 FENSA has grown to become the largest and longest established Competent Person Scheme within the replacement window and door industry, recently issuing its 13 millionth homeowner certificate.

Now FENSA members have the chance to meet the FENSA team in person at their local FENSA Roadshow event and get valuable updates, insights and inspections advice.

GGF to exhibit at Security & Counter Terror Expo 2018

Events, News | 18.01.18

The Glass and Glazing Federation (GGF) is pleased to announce its support for the upcoming Security & Counter Terror Expo at Olympia London this March

Security & Counter Terror Expo (SCTX) is the UK’s leading national security event and takes place this year at Olympia London from 6th-7th March.

GGF Technical staff and representatives from the GGF Window Film Group will be on hand at SCTX 2018 to offer advice and discuss all matters glass and glazing, especially in relation to security and safety such as the use of window film and lamination in bomb containment and ballistic reduction.

The first 10 visitors on the GGF stand on each day of SCTX 2018 will be able to pick up a free copy of the GGF Safety and Security Glazing Good Practice Guide. This comprehensive publication, valued at £150, covers the use of safety and security glass and glazing in buildings including not just windows, doors and curtain walling, but also interiors such as shower enclosures and elevator enclosures.

Security & Counter Terror Expo is a world-class showcase of the capabilities, strategies and intelligence to keep nations, infrastructure, business and people safe with more than 10,000 professionals from Government, Private Sector, Critical National Infrastructure, Military, Law Enforcement, Transport Security, Border Security, Security Services, Major Events and Emergency Services.

Hazlemere Commercial Secure £270K Window, Door & Curtain Wall Contracts At Reading University

Members News | 01.11.17

Having previously been contracted in recent times by Reading University to successfully complete a comprehensive £715,000 + VAT window and door replacement programme of their JJ Thomson Building & Mathematics Department Building on the University of Reading’s impressive Whiteknight campus in 2016, GGF Members Hazlemere Commercial have, as a result of their existing on-site track record, secured several new upgrade projects to carry out an additional £270,000 + VAT of refurbishment works to the Wager Building, the Allen Laboratory and Reading University Students Union Building.
Interestingly enough, the Wager building at Reading University was formerly known as the Geoscience building. It was named the Wager building after Dr Lawrence Rickard Wager, who was employed by the University in 1929 as Junior Lecturer in Geology. Wager published a seminal piece of work on petrology (the study of rocks) in 1939 that is still widely cited today, and he undertook some truly extraordinary scientific and personal feats during his time at Reading, including an expedition to the summit of Everest in 1933. The expedition reached the highest point achieved on Everest (28,100 ft) without oxygen at the time, and was not bettered until 1978.

The work on the Students Union building involves the surveying, then manufacture and installation of white powder coated Sapa Dualframe 75 SI Window Wall, vertically sliding Sapa Dualslide replacement double glazed windows (with a tilt in facility) and a thermally broken Sapa Stormframe STII commercial aluminium entrance door.

The refurbishments works to the Wager Building and Allen Laboratory are more extensive, involving the replacement of approximately 200 existing worm out non thermally broken windows and two existing tired entrance doors. The bespoke products being fabricated and fitted by Hazlemere Commercial into the Wager Building and Allen Laboratory are two hundred powder coated double glazed dual colour Sapa Dualframe 75 SI aluminium casement windows that are RAL 7011 gloss grey externally and RAL 9910 gloss white on the inside. In addition, Reading University have ordered two unique Sapa Stormframe STII dual colour high-traffic commercial aluminium entrance doors from Hazlemere Commercial that are RAL 3011 Brown Red (Ruby in colour) powder coated externally and RAL 9910 white gloss internally. Both these external access doors have a electronic entry system for high security.

Reading University Students’ Union Building, like the Wager Building and Allen Laboratory are each situated on the 320 acre Whiteknights parkland campus. The Students’ Union has a 2,000 capacity nightclub, a lively bar serving beverages and pub style food and a relaxing Cafe. The venues hold a range of activities from local bands, quiz and karaoke, comedy nights and regular parties.

All the high quality thermally broken energy efficient bespoke commercial aluminium windows and doors ordered by the University of Reading from GGF Members Hazlemere Commercial are manufactured in their modern high-tech 38,000 square foot factory premises in the nearby town of High Wycombe in South Buckinghamshire, then installed on-site by their teams of experienced commercial window and door fitters.
